What is the Microsoft Office SDX Helper process?
The Microsoft Office SDX Helper or Sdxhelper.exe is a process related to Microsoft Office. It is Microsoft’s secure download manager that enables secure download and update of Office modules. This process runs in the background and doesn’t consume much CPU and other CPU resources. However, some users have complained of high CPU usage of about 50-60% by Sdxhelper.exe. This problem is crucial as it slows down the PC and prevents you from using your system normally. Now, if you are facing the same problem, this article is intended to help you out. You can find all the possible fixes to resolve the problem.
What causes high CPU usage of SDXHelper.exe?
Here are the possible causes for high CPU usage of SDXHelper.exe on Windows 11/10:
The problem may occur if Office and Windows are not up to date.It can also be caused due to corrupted or faulty installation of Microsoft Office.Antivirus interference can also result in the same issue.Corrupted Office Document Cache is another reason for the same problem.
Can I disable Microsoft Office SDX Helper?
You can disable Microsoft Office SDX Helper or SDXHelper.exe. But then, you will have to manually install features and other updates of Office.
Fix Microsoft Office SDX Helper High Disk or CPU Usage
If Microsoft Office SDX Helper (SDXHelper.exe) displays high Memory, Disk or CPU Usage then here’s what you need to do to resolve the problem. Let us discuss these solutions in detail now!
1] Update Office
This problem may occur if you are using outdated versions of Office. So, make sure you are using the latest version of Microsoft Office. If your Office is not up to date, install all the available updates. For that, you can use the following steps:
2] Update Windows to the Latest Build
You need to make sure that both Windows and Office are up to date. If there is an incompatibility issue between OS and Office modules, it can cause the problem of high CPU usage of Microsoft Office SDX Helper. So, make sure your Windows is updated to the latest build and if it is not updated, update Windows and then see if the problem is resolved. You can open the Windows Settings app and then navigate to the Windows Update tab and then check for updates. After that, download and install Windows updates. If the problem occurs again, you can try the next potential fix to fix the error. Read: Fix Services and Controller app High CPU usage.
3] Add Exception for SDX Helper in your Antivirus
In case your antivirus is interfering with the Office module update operations, this issue may arise. Hence, adding Sdxhelper.exe to the exception list of your antivirus might help you resolve the issue. To do that, follow below steps: See: Microsoft Excel causes High CPU usage when running on Windows.
4] Clear the Office Document Cache
This problem may be triggered in the case of a corrupted Office Document cache. So, clearing the office Document cache should enable you to fix the issue at hand. Here are the steps to do that:
You can also manually clear the Office document cache by going to the following location and deleting all the files:
Replace
5] Disable some tasks in Task Scheduler
If the issue still persists, you can try disabling some relevant tasks from Task Scheduler to counter the problem. These tasks include Office Feature Updates and Office Feature Updates Logon tasks. Do note that after disabling these tasks, you will need to manually update the Office applications. Here are the steps to disable relevant tasks in Task Scheduler: You can also run the below commands (one by one) in Powershell (Admin) to disable the above tasks:
6] Rename the SDX Helper File
If none of the above solutions work for you, try renaming the SDX Helper file. Some users have reportedly fixed the problem using this workaround, and it might just work for you as well. However, after renaming it, you may have to update Office manually. Here are the steps for renaming the SDX Helper file: First, open Task Manager and end the SDXHelper.exe process. Now, navigate to the following address in File Explorer: The above location may vary for you, so navigate to whichever location where the file is present. Next, select and right-click on sdxhelper.exe, and from the context menu, click on Rename. After that, enter the new name with an extension. For example, you can use a name like sdxhelper1.new When the file is renamed, check whether the problem is resolved or not. Read: Service Host Delivery Optimization High Network, Disk or CPU usage.
7] Repair Office
The high CPU usage of Sdxhelper.exe can be caused due to a corrupted or faulty installation of the Office suite. If the scenario is applicable to you, you should be able to fix the problem by repairing the Office suite. To perform Office repair, here are the steps to follow:
8] Reinstall Office
If none of the above solutions work for you, the last resort is to reinstall the entire Office suite on your PC. The problem might lie with the corrupted installation of Office modules which is beyond repair. So, check with a fresh installation, it might resolve the problem for you. Firstly, you will have to completely uninstall the Microsoft office suite using the Settings app. Then, move the following address in File Explorer and delete the Office folder: Next, go to the following address and delete folders named Microsoft Office and/or Microsoft Office 15 When done, download the latest version of the Office suite from an official source and then install it on your system. Hopefully, this will help you get rid of the problem of SDX Helper high CPU usage See: Modern Setup Host high CPU or Memory usage.
How do I fix Microsoft Office SDX helper has stopped working?
If Microsoft Office SDX helper has stopped working, the problem might be caused due to corrupted installation of Microsoft Office. You can try repairing Office using Quick Repair or Online Repair. If that doesn’t help, uninstall and then reinstall Microsoft Office on your PC. That’s it! Now read:
What Is Spooler SubSystem app & why the High CPU usage?Microsoft Office Click-To-Run High CPU usage.